What's Happening?
Accent Resources has entered into a binding agreement to sell its Norseman Gold Project to Boomerang Mining Capital for up to A$4 million. The project, located in Western Australia, is part of a highly mineralized greenstone belt. Under the agreement,
Accent retains rights to iron ore and platinum group elements, while Boomerang will manage gold mining operations. The deal includes a 4% gross revenue royalty for Accent, with an option for Boomerang to reduce this royalty.
Why It's Important?
This transaction represents a strategic move for Accent Resources, allowing it to focus on its core iron ore strategy while benefiting from the potential success of the gold project through retained royalties. For Boomerang, acquiring the Norseman Gold Project enhances its portfolio and positions it to capitalize on the gold market. What's Next?
Completion of the sale is contingent upon due diligence and regulatory approvals. Once finalized, Boomerang will commence preparations for gold mining operations, potentially boosting local economic activity and employment. The ongoing royalty arrangement ensures Accent remains financially invested in the project's success, aligning interests between the two companies.
